Vue是一種流行的JavaScript框架,它提供了許多可用于構(gòu)建大型Web應(yīng)用程序的功能。一個重要的方面是,在Vue.js中有一些內(nèi)置的工具來幫助您編寫更好的代碼并避免常見的錯誤。一個這樣的工具是ESLint。
ESLint是一個靜態(tài)代碼分析工具,能夠識別并報告代碼中的常見問題和潛在的錯誤。在Vue.js項(xiàng)目中,可以使用Vue CLI來創(chuàng)建基本項(xiàng)目結(jié)構(gòu),并自動為您配置ESLint。這意味著您可以立即開始編寫更好的代碼,而無需在時間上耗費(fèi)太多精力來配置工具。
module.exports = { root: true, env: { node: true, }, 'extends': [ 'plugin:vue/essential', 'eslint:recommended', ], parserOptions: { parser: 'babel-eslint', }, rules: { 'no-console': process.env.NODE_ENV === 'production' ? 'error' : 'off', 'no-debugger': process.env.NODE_ENV === 'production' ? 'error' : 'off', }, };
盡管Vue.js中內(nèi)置了ESLint,但您仍然可以自定義它的行為以滿足您的需要。一個簡單的方法是在項(xiàng)目根目錄中創(chuàng)建一個名為.eslintrc.js的文件,并在其中添加您自己的規(guī)則和擴(kuò)展。
在編寫Vue.js應(yīng)用程序時,使用本機(jī)ESLint geat可以大大提高代碼質(zhì)量和可維護(hù)性。無需擔(dān)心常見的錯誤,您可以專注于編寫更強(qiáng)大的代碼,從而為用戶提供更好的體驗(yàn)。